Hundreds of potential Businessmen at the first Sarajevo Unlimited

Published November 4, 2016
Share
SHARE

[wzslider autoplay=”true”]

The Sarajevo Unlimited Forum, which hosted some of the greatest names of regional and global world of business innovations and which was organized by the business and innovation center Networks, was successfully completed yesterday afternoon in the Hotel Holiday in Sarajevo.

Young businessmen and those who want to become businessmen had the opportunity to present their startups and ideas to potential investors and representatives of major, established companies.

Sarajevo Unlimited was attended by several hundreds of interested people who followed the lectures and panels in which more than 30 speakers participated, expressing their viewpoints through discussion and constructive talk. Among them were Google’s Online Marketing Consultant Alfred Tolle and Director of the Microsoft Cloud Service for Southeastern Europe Ratko Mutavdžić.

Three panels were organized within the Unlimited Arena and the participants were Zlatko Lagumdžija, Peter Geršak from the IBM, Bakir Skenderović from ASA Prevent Group, and many other interesting experts like Nedim Sabic, Jasenko Hodzic, Armin Konjalić and many others.

The aim of the Unlimited was to raise awareness about the success of BiH companies which are connected on global level and which make a substantial part of the world business mainstream. Also, the Unlimited was aimed at encouraging young entrepreneurs.

The Sarajevo Unlimited was organized in partnership with Phillip Morris International, the Youth Employment Project, the Embassy of Switzerland in BiH, the International University of Sarajevo, Microsoft and AmCham – the American trade chamber in BiH. The forum was supported by the Council of Ministers of BiH, Government of the Sarajevo Canton and the U.S. Embassy in BiH.

Sponsors of the forum were the City of Sarajevo, Mistral, Symphony, ProCredit Bank, ViaMedia, Telemach, Oracle, Southeastern Europe Youth Network, Bisnode, BH Telecom, Foundation Networks, FotoArt, Akta.ba, Hotel Holiday and Unioninvestplastika. PR partner of the forum is the agency Prime Communications.

(Source: klix.ba)
